Muscle-Specific Kinase Antibodies (Anti-MuSK)

IgG4 subclass autoantibodies targeting the extracellular domain of muscle-specific receptor tyrosine kinase (MuSK) at the neuromuscular junction.

Molecular Mechanism & Clinical Purpose

Disrupts agrin-LRP4-MuSK phosphorylation signaling, preventing acetylcholine receptor clustering and synaptic maintenance without complement.

Differential Diagnosis

Elevated Levels (Anti-MuSK High)

  • •MuSK-positive Myasthenia Gravis (predominantly bulbar, neck, and respiratory weakness)
  • •AChR-seronegative myasthenia

Low Levels (Anti-MuSK Low)

  • •AChR-positive myasthenia gravis
  • •Healthy neuromuscular junction
